## Summary

The Nottingham University Hospitals NHS Trust has awarded a contract for the maintenance of high voltage equipment, including low voltage switchgear, to Serconnect Ltd. This procurement process falls under the 'Repair and maintenance services of electrical building installations' industry category, located in Nottingham, East Midlands, United Kingdom. The contract involves planned preventative maintenance and reactive maintenance at Nottingham City Hospital, Queen's Medical Centre, Ropewalk House, and the National Rehabilitation Centre. The procurement was conducted as a selective call-off from a framework agreement, with a total estimated value of £265,000. The contract period is set to begin on 1 May 2026 and will run until 30 April 2030, with an initial term of 12 months and the option to extend for three further 12-month periods. Nottingham University Hospitals NHS Trust, the buyer, completed the award stage on 31 March 2026.

## Notice

Nottingham University Hospitals NHS Trust (The Customer) has procured a contract for ongoing planned preventative maintenance (e.g. testing, servicing and maintenance) as well as reactive maintenance (E.g. responding to faults and failures, subsequent investigation, repair and testing) of its High Voltage Equipment and Low Voltage Switchgear. The objective is to ensure the Customer's equipment remains safe, reliable, and operates with optimum efficiency. The Services include, but are not limited to, testing, servicing and maintenance of the Customer's High Voltage Equipment incorporating Low Voltage Switchgear Maintenance at Nottingham City Hospital, Queen's Medical Centre, Ropewalk House and the National Rehabilitation Centre. The ring main units are to be serviced and maintained every 4 years with service visits conducted on an annual basis for transformers in line with OEM recommendations and HTM 06-03. The Services will comprise planned maintenance, with provisions for fault and response restoration (Reactive Maintenance) as additional costs. Estimate costs associated with Reactive Maintenance have been included in the values in this notice, however, this may increase or decrease depending on the number of faults with the HV equipment, for example. The contract also includes provision for any work to the Customer's private HV network as well as any work required to upgrade the Distribution Network Operators network (E.g. where additional capacity is required ). The Term is 12 months with the option to extend for a further 36 months. This extension shall take the form of three 12-month incremental periods. The Contract has been procured via Lot 2 (Highway Electrical Connections on DNO/IDNO Networks ('Contestable' Works) and privately-owned cables, and Minor Installation Works) of the ESPO 256_24 (Highway Electrical Connections provided by Independent Connection Providers (2024)) Framework: https://www.espo.org/highway-electrical-connections-provided-by-independent-connection-providers-256-24.html
